Join me, as I travel south west of Surrey into the South Downs. We will leave the market town of Petersfield behind us as we walk south down to the pretty village of Buriton. The first hill of the day will take us up to and into the Queen Elizabeth Country Park, where we will stop to use the toilets in the visitors centre. 

A packed lunch will be had sitting on the top of the next hill, Butser. This is where we turn around and start heading north, though the hamlet of Ramsdean and stopping in Stroud for a drink in the pub. The final hill of the day in up Stoner Hill and back into Petersfield.
